NVIDIA Quadro 410 vs NVIDIA Quadro K6000
NVIDIA Quadro 410 vs NVIDIA Quadro K6000
VS
NVIDIA Quadro 410
NVIDIA Quadro K6000
We compared two Professional market GPUs: 512MB VRAM Quadro 410 and 12GB VRAM Quadro K6000 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A Quadro 410 's Advantages
Lower TDP (38W vs 225W)
NVIDIA Quadro K6000 's Advantages
Released 11 months late
Boost Clock902MHz
Larger VRAM bandwidth (288.4GB/s vs 14.26GB/s)
2688 additional rendering cores
